GIC, Tishman to sell WaveRock in Hyderabad for Rs2,000 crore


The year gone by saw a number of large investments by global majors in Indian real estate. Ltd and New York-based developer Tishman Speyer are set to sell their Hyderabad-based office property WaveRock for Rs2,000 crore, said two people aware of the development. WaveRock is an equal joint venture between GIC and Tishman Speyer, spread over 2.5 million sq. In 2015, GIC picked up 50% stake in Tishman Speyer’s WaveRock and both expanded the property to 2.5 million sq. The year 2018 is also likely to see continued momentum and strong inflows into commercial office assets, said the Cushman & Wakefield report.
